Where to Celebrate Memorial Day 2013 in Boston

There are several Memorial Day events across Boston, including two in the Parkway area.

 

Today the Gardens at Gethsemane in West Roxbury is holding its 45th Annual Memorial Day Service on Memorial Day beginning at 9:30 am. 

The West Roxbury VFW Post 2902 will conduct a ceremony. State Sen. Mike Rush, a lieutenant in the US Navy Reserves will serve as keynote speaker. A dedication of the Brigadier General William J. Gormley, III Memorial Bench will occur during the service.

There are also several services planned around Boston.

In the morning, there will be an 8 a.m. service at the Fogg-Roberts American Legion Post 78 (56 Harvard Ave.) in Hyde Park. From there, participants will march to a Mass at Most Precious Blood Parish (43 Maple St.) and then return to the post for the start of a tour of local veteran’s squares. The procession will end up at the Civil War Memorial at Fairview Cemetery for the closing ceremony at 11 a.m.

In the afternoon, a Memorial Day observance will be held in Brighton from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. at Evergreen Cemetery (2060 Commonwealth Ave.).

Later on, there will be a free concert featuring the Metropolitan Wind Symphony and the Boston City Singers to honor veterans. The show, called "Remembrance 2013: A Musical Tribute to Our Heroes," will be held at 6:30 p.m. at Christopher Columbus Park (110 Atlantic Ave.) in the North End.
